WebPhillip Martin Simms (born November 3, 1955) is an American former professional football player who was a quarterback for 15 years, spending his entire career with the New York Giants of the National Football League (NFL). Phil Simms - Wikipedia The Giants crushed the Denver Broncos 39-20 in Super Bowl XXI, and Simms, the game's MVP, personally carved them up with the best percentage passing day in Super Bowl historyin any NFL championship game ever, for that matter. He completed 22 of 25 passes for 268 yards, setting Super Bowl records for consecutive completions (10), accuracy (88%), and passer rating (150.9). Before that draft, Bill Walsh, the legendary 49ers coach whose so-called West Coast Offense of precisely timed pass patterns was designed to make stars out of quarterbacks, had come to Morehead State to work Simms out. Before he left, Walsh told Simms two things: First, that the 49ers would draft him if he were still available with their first pick, the 29th overall. When Simmss name was announced by Commissioner Pete Rozelle in front of the audience at the draft in New York, his selection was booed loudly by the Giants fans in attendance. Simms quieted his critics after his first year, taking over the starting quarterback job in Week 5 and leading his team to a 6-4 record in his starts, good enough to be runner up to Ottis Anderson for Offensive Rookie of the Year. The Giants, led by quarterback Phil Simms, running back Joe Morris, and their Big Blue Wrecking Crew defense, advanced to their first Super Bowl after posting a 142 regular season record and only allowing a combined total of 3 points in their two postseason wins.
